
UI:用户看到的界面,可以是asp.net ,winform 等等 对编码影响不大 可以最后实现
SF: 处理异常 等特殊操作
BF:操作方法集,用来调用实现方法
BE:实体 包含各类数据 DataSet ……
BR:规则类, 主要用来验证(非空,格式,是否存在 等等约束)
DA: 数据操作类,专门用来操作数据库的增删改查
软件架构分层详解
本文详细介绍了软件架构中常见的分层设计模式,包括用户界面(UI)、业务规则(BR)、业务逻辑(BF)等不同层面的作用及其实现方式。探讨了如何通过合理的分层来提高系统的可维护性和扩展性。

UI:用户看到的界面,可以是asp.net ,winform 等等 对编码影响不大 可以最后实现
SF: 处理异常 等特殊操作
BF:操作方法集,用来调用实现方法
BE:实体 包含各类数据 DataSet ……
BR:规则类, 主要用来验证(非空,格式,是否存在 等等约束)
DA: 数据操作类,专门用来操作数据库的增删改查

被折叠的 条评论
为什么被折叠?